Output 277066bb21b8edd63bf19b0b20695b1943db54cfb3f6bd0ae4bdfbb1c24be29d:0

value
906987
script pubkey
OP_0 OP_PUSHBYTES_20 70741e34c6b07b4a38a1cdb8c3f68deff90c4cb7
address
bc1qwp6pudxxkpa55w9pekuv8a5daluscn9hj39mx5
transaction
277066bb21b8edd63bf19b0b20695b1943db54cfb3f6bd0ae4bdfbb1c24be29d
spent
true